Community-Driven Research Day (CDRD) is a program that encourages collaboration between researchers and community-based organizations (CBOs) or community groups that have research questions they are interested in answering.

Through live presentations, CBOs and community groups will highlight their questions to CDRD participants, who will include area non-profits, community groups, public sector partners and researchers from CHOP, Drexel University, Philadelphia College of Osteopathic Medicine, Temple University College of Public Health, Thomas Jefferson University and University of Pennsylvania. CBOs, community groups, academic researchers, and students will be able to meet virtually and discuss potential, mutually-beneficial collaborations.

This year's theme is "Advancing Health and Equity Through Community-Academic Partnerships."
